Directions:
Heat oven to 375. Grease a large cookie sheet. In small bowl, combine
cream cheese, marmalade and raisins; blend well. Separate dough into
20 biscuits. Press or roll each biscuit to a 4-inch circle.
Spoon 1 tablespoon cream cheese mixture on center of 10 of the
biscuits; top with remaining biscuits. Press edges with fork to seal;
cut five 1/2-inch slits, 1 inch apart,around 1 side of each biscuit
to resemble a bear claw.
In small bowl, combine almonds and sugar. Dip top of each biscuit in
orange juice;sprinkle with almond mixture. Place biscuits on greased
cookie sheet. Bake at 375 for 15 to 20 minutes or until golden brown.
Cool 1 minute,remove from cookie sheet. Cool 10 minutes before
serving. Store in refrigerator. Makes 10 bear claws.
